图47-a图是三个计算机局域网A,B和C,分别包含10台,8台和5台计算机,通过路由器互联,并通过该路由器接口d联入因特网。路由器各端口名分别为a、b、c和d(假设端口d接入IP地址为61.60.21.80的互联网地址)。LAN A和LAN B公用一个C类IP地址(网络地址为202.38.60.0),并将此IP地址中主机地址的高两位作为子网编号。A网的子网编号为01,B网的子网编号为10。主机号的低6位作为子网中的主机编号。C网的IP网络号为202.36.61.0。请回答如下问题:
(1)为每个网络中的计算机和路由器的端口分配IP地址;
(2)写出三个网段的子网掩码;
(3)列出路由器的路由表;
(4)LAN B上的一台主机要向B网段广播一个分组,请填写此分组的目的地址;
(5)LAN B上的一台主机要向C网段广播一个分组,请填写此分组的目的地址。
参考答案:[解答] (1)路由器a 202.38.60.65 255.255.255.192,b 202.38.60.129,255.255.255.192
c 202.38.61.1 255.255.255.0,d 61.60.21.80 255.0.0.0
(2)A:255.255.255.192 B:255.255.255.192 C:255.255.255.0
(3)路由器的路由表如下表所示:
(4)分组的目的地址是202.38.60.191 目的网络地址 子网掩码 下一跳地址 接口 202.38.60.64 255.255.255.192 直连 a 202.38.60.128 255.255.255.192 直连 b 202.38.61.0 255.255.255.0 直连 c 61.0.0.0 255.0.0.0 直连 d 0.0.0.0 0.0.0.0 61.60.21.80 d
(5)分组的目的地址是202.38.61.255
解析: 本题主要考查网络设备路由器地址分配的一般原则,路由表的原理,子网划分和子网掩码。首先要根据题意给出LAN A和LAN B的子网,这里A网的子网编号为01,也就是202.38.60.0100 0000,即202.38.60.64,因此一般选择该网络最小的地址分配给路由器的a接口,也就是202.38.60.0100 0001,即202.38.60.65,子网掩码为255.255.255.192。同理B网的子网编号为10,202.38.60.1000 0000,即202.38.60.128,b接口的地址为202.38.60.1000 0001,即202.38.60.129,子网掩码是255.255.255.192。对于C网,C接口的地址为202.38.61.1,掩码为255.255.255.0。问题1—3就可以求解了,针对问题4-5,也就是子网的广播地址,对于B网段,其广播地址为202.38.60.1011 1111,即202.38.60.191,对于C网段,就是标准的202.38.61.255。
[归纳总结] 网络号或主机号为0或1的地址是特殊地址,从不分配给某个单独的主机;
①具有有效的网络号但主机号全为0的地址保留给网络本身;
②具有有效的网络号但主机号全为1的地址保留作为定向广播,即在网络号指定的网络中广播;
③32位全1的地址称为本地广播地址,表示仅在发送节点所在的网络中广播;
④32位全0的地址指示本机;
⑤网络号为0但主机号有效的地址指代本网中的主机;
⑥形如127.xx.yy.xx的地址保留作为回路测试,发送到这个地址的分组不输出到线路上,而是送回内部的接收端。